Position: Occupational Therapist Assistant
Salary Range: $31.20 - $34.28 per hour
Hours: 32 hours per week Monday - Friday no weekend rotation
Facility: Skilled Nursing Facility (SNF) providing both short term and long term care
We are seeking a skilled and dedicated Occupational Therapist Assistant to join our team at our Skilled Nursing Facility. Our facility provides both short term and long term care to our residents and we are committed to helping them achieve their highest level of independence and quality of life.
As an Occupational Therapist Assistant you will work under the supervision of a licensed Occupational Therapist to provide rehabilitative services to our residents. Your main responsibility will be to assist in the implementation of individualized treatment plans and help our residents improve their daily living and functional skills. You will also work closely with other members of the therapy team to ensure the best possible outcomes for our residents.
Key Responsibilities:
- Assist in the development and implementation of treatment plans for residents
- Work with residents to help improve their daily living and functional skills
- Provide therapeutic interventions such as exercises activities and adaptive equipment
- Monitor and document resident progress and adjust treatment plans as needed
- Communicate effectively with residents families and other healthcare professionals
- Collaborate with other members of the therapy team to ensure coordinated and comprehensive care for residents
- Maintain accurate and timely documentation of all treatments and progress notes
- Adhere to all facility and regulatory guidelines and standards
Qualifications:
- Associates degree in Occupational Therapy Assistant program
- Current state license or eligibility for state licensure
- Previous experience in a skilled nursing facility or long term care setting preferred
- Strong communication and interpersonal skills
- Ability to work independently and as part of a team
- Compassionate and patient-centered approach to care
- Strong organizational and time management skills
